How to Refurbish an Old Dining Table
Step 1: Gather the Supplies
If you're ready to give your old dining table a new lease on life, the first step is to gather all the necessary supplies. You'll need a screwdriver, sandpaper, a paintbrush, furniture wax, and your choice of paint, stain, or varnish. Depending on the type of wood your table is made from, you may also need wood filler, wood putty, or wood glue. Gather these supplies before starting the project, so you're not running around looking for something when you need it.
Step 2: Remove the Old Finish
The next step is to remove the old finish from the dining table. This can be done with sandpaper or a chemical stripper. If you use sandpaper, start with a coarse grit and gradually move up to a finer grit. If you use a chemical stripper, follow the directions on the packaging and make sure to wear protective gloves. Once you've removed all the old finish, wipe the table down with a damp cloth to remove any dust or debris.
Step 3: Fill in Any Gaps or Imperfections
Once the old finish has been removed, you'll be able to see any gaps or imperfections in the wood. If there are any large gaps or cracks, you'll need to fill them in with wood filler or wood putty. If there are any small holes in the wood, you can use wood glue to fill them in. Once the filler or glue has dried, you can sand it down so it is even with the rest of the surface.
Step 4: Stain, Paint, or Varnish the Table
Now you can give your dining table the look you want. If you're going for a more traditional look, you can stain the wood. If you're looking for something more modern, you can paint it. Or, if you want a high-gloss finish, you can varnish it. Whichever look you choose, make sure to follow the directions on the product you are using.
Step 5: Wax the Table
Once you've finished staining, painting, or varnishing the table, the last step is to wax it. Furniture wax helps protect the finish and makes it easier to clean the table. Apply the wax in a thin, even layer and then buff it with a soft, clean cloth.
